Secret Factors to Think About When Choosing Craft Cable

1. Cord Gauge and Adaptability
The gauge of the cable determines its density. Thinner wires ( greater gauge numbers) are excellent for delicate designs, while thicker cables are better suited for much heavier beads or structural items. Versatility likewise matters; cords with more strands (e.g., 19 or 49-strand wires) offer better pliability and drape, making them suitable for detailed layouts.

2. Product and Coating
Craft wires are readily available in different products such as stainless steel, copper, silver, and gold. Your selection should depend on your style preferences, budget plan, and prospective allergic reactions. Nylon-coated wires are specifically preferred for their included longevity and resistance to fraying.

3. Stamina and Longevity
Guarantee the wire can sustain the weight of your grains or beauties. For much heavier beads like gemstones or crystals, go with sturdier wires with greater strand counts.

4. Compatibility with Grains
The cord size must fit through the bead holes without compromising stamina. For smaller grain holes, such as those in seed grains or semi-precious stones, finer wires are needed.

5. Task Type
Take into consideration whether your task requires wire that holds its shape (e.g., for sculptures) or one that drapes elegantly (e.g., necklaces). This will affect whether you choose solid jewelry cord or adaptable beading cable.
